With barely nine days to the all-important final round Nations Cup qualifier against the Lone Star of Liberia, management of the national team assumed another dimension when the technical and medical crew at yesterday’s training started fishing out for hidden injuries by players.
Head Coach Stephen Okechukwu Keshi, who led the secret search , unknown to the players said it was important because some of the highly rated players might have hidden injuries and that would not help the cause of the nation, hence the need to fish them out by the technical and medical crew.
After a close examination of the players during their pre-training exercises, no serious detection was made but not before the crew including team doctor, Ibrahim Gyaran, physiotherapist; Wale Oladejo, pulled out Kabiru Umar and Benjamin Francis for special attention.
“The team is physically intact and there is no cause for alarm, we just want to ensure that all our players are in good shape since they have been away from the national camp for sometimes”.
After the medical examination, the team medical doctor, Gyaran, said that there were no serious injury worries, as the exercise was just a routine one targeted at players who were part of the Federations Cup final and third place games played at the weekend in Lagos.
